James Kaelan’s WE’RE GETTING ON is a must have

Like all of you BigOther contributors & readers, I am passionate about books. & when I read a book that I love, I have to spread the word.

I received Jame Kaelan’s signed, first (seeded cover) edition of WE’RE GETTING ON, & was blown away. I had read some excerpts of this book early on & was worried, just in part, that perhaps the Zero Emission Tour & seeded-cover (while genius & wonderful) would overshadow the book or make more of the story than it actually was. Not the case, not at all.

Holding the seeded cover is a tremendous feeling, the art & titling are letterpress quality & beautiful, & being a part of something new & big & different is a bad-ass moment for sure. & then I read the story, this narrative of a man who wants to break down the world, or at least himself, & I was enthralled. The language is just concrete enough to make for a quick & smooth read while also remaining poetic enough to avoid any genre labels.The narrative is gritty & unexpected, the characters not inundated with expositional elements but rather cast in quick, shadowed light, the way characters should be written. A dance of words on a page that turns into a spruce tree.
